Output ede316ee6e3776de5cd9bcea2907557b20f869f973e2902f71ed03d4d15af590:0

value
1506301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ba91dc1b914f410fb5b400d6d5d5a560aa3440d6 OP_EQUAL
address
3JhWLjuEst753ojg2KmfG1rKJpr1zsDaby
transaction
ede316ee6e3776de5cd9bcea2907557b20f869f973e2902f71ed03d4d15af590
spent
true